yRoJCFXKoYqlgxoicSgyQibninMpQFzDjEIupchgcrfRVIxrIdmuMEaXleXCkxVLAhaKWEZKvFcZiYbCRLMXPeYPAIPFbVbSZPXWKpOVvcbMggfmGAYHLTozNqZweWTsDJKsNEHIIcVMXMQIcQTavnOztWpaeVRKbbfLKGwLNyphZIdtUpHXqDQ